The 15th annual World Usability Day (WUD) event will be celebrated globally on November 12, 2020. Programs will be organized in over 40 countries around the world. The Northeast Ohio chapter of the User Experience Professionals Association (UXPA CLE) has been hosting this event since 2005 for members and associated students, professionals and user advocates in the region.
Time: 8:45 am - Opening Announcements 9:00 am - Opening Keynote, AmberNechole Hart, Why Does Siri Sound White? 10:00 am - Jeremy Belcher, from IA to AI - The Evolution of User Experience Design 11:00 am - Carol Smith, Implementing Ethics in Emerging Technologies 12:00 pm - Lunch + Networking 1:00 pm - Susan Hura, The Duet of Conversation 2:00 pm - Steve Wendel, Automated Behavior Change 3:00 pm - Claire Pacheco, Building User Trust with Machine Learning Products 3:50 pm - Closing Announcements + Raffle
